Narasingapur
Narasingapur is a village located in Contai I subdivision of Purba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. Tamluk and Contai are the district & sub-district headquarters of Narasingapur village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Nayaput is the gram panchayat of Narasingapur village.

About Narasingapur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Narasingapur is 346218. The village spans a total geographical area of 64.3 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 721401. Contai is nearest town to Narasingap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.

Population of Narasingapur
Below is a concise population overview of Narasingapur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 605 | 322 | 283 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 52 | 28 | 24 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 526 | 287 | 239 |
Illiterate Population | 79 | 35 | 44 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Narasingapur village:
- The total population of Narasingapur village is around 605, including approximately 322 males and 283 females, with a sex ratio of 878 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 52 children aged 0–6 years in Narasingapur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- The literacy rate of Narasingapur village is about 86.94%, with male literacy at 89.13% and female literacy at 84.45%.
- There are around 130 households in Narasingapur village.
Connectivity of Narasingapur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Narasingapur. As per the 2011 stats, Narasingap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
